Nyle Patrick HEALY

HEALY, Nyle Patrick

Service Numbers: 1/400246, 1400246
Enlisted: Not yet discovered
Last Rank: Private
Last Unit: 3rd Battalion, The Royal Australian Regiment (3RAR)
Born: Oakey, Queensland, Australia , 30 June 1931
Home Town: Toowoomba, Toowoomba, Queensland
Schooling: Toowoomba South State School, , Queensland, Australia
Occupation: Soldier
Died: Killed in Action, Korea, 8 May 1953, aged 21 years
Cemetery: United Nations Memorial Cemetery, Busan, Korea
Location 35-2-2 Grave no. 2894
Memorials: Acland War Memorial, Australian War Memorial Roll of Honour, Korea United Nations Memorial Cemetery Wall of Remembrance, Toowoomba District Servicemen Roll of Honour, Toowoomba Roll of Honour WW2, Toowoomba War Memorial (Mothers' Memorial)
